Dithionitrobenzoic acid (DTNB) is a chemical compound used in various laboratory applications. It is a colorimetric reagent that reacts with sulfhydryl groups, commonly found in proteins, to produce a yellow-colored product. The quantification of this yellow color can be used to determine the concentration of sulfhydryl groups in a sample.

Spectrophotometric Cholinesterase Inhibition Assay

Check if the same lab product or an alternative is used in the 5 most similar protocols
Inhibition of human serum cholinesterase was measured spectrophotometrically using a Konelab 20 analyzer (Thermofisher Scientific, Helsinki, Finland) with flow thermostated cells, length 7 mm (at 405 nm wavelength). Anti-cholinesterase activity was measured as described before [36 (link)]. Butyrylthiocholine iodide (purity > 99%), dithio-nitro benzoic acid (DTNB) and neostygmine bromide were purchased from Sigma Co., St. Louis, Missouri, USA. All other chemicals and reagents used [NaH2PO4-Na2HPO4, butylhydroxytoluene (BHT), dimethilsulphoxid (DMSO)] were purchased from Merck, Darmstadt, Germany.
